About CENSA
CENSA – (Computer Engineering Students’ Assocation): established in the year of 1991, vibrant association of staff and students provides a platform for all round development by conducting technical events throughout the year. Department R&D is very active with faculties being engaged in research and paper publication in various high-index journals. The department id proud that the final year projects from both UG and Pg cadre have been accepted to be published in various international journals.
Our department is constantly training the students to achieve their professional goals. Department is continuously conducting technical talks , seminars, soft skill training by industrial professionals to bridge the gap with the industries. Also, students are motivated to participate in intra and inter college technical events which will enhance their personality.
